Does birdiesync support synchronizing muliple categories in appintments?

I've used the trial version of 2.0.0.1, and I am not able to do this.

It seems like Lightning only supports one category, so I've tried to get around this by synchronizing to mulitiple calendars. But it seems like only the first category listed for the appointment is synchronized. Is there any way around this?

Hello kjetilmh,

The problem is that if you synchronize the same appointment with 3 categories in 3 different calendars (one for each category), you no longer respect the one to one correspondence of the synchronization (one mobile device item matched on desktop item). And if you modify the event in one desktop calendar, the modification would be transfered to the mobile device. So either it would be necessary to then update the 2 other events in the 2 other desktop calendars, or you would have differences between the mobile device event and the 2 other events in the desktop calendars. That would complicate things a bit...
So I think that it's difficult to manage multiple categories in events if Lightning/Sunbird don't support them as billywill mentioned it.
Note that with contacts, you may be able to separate categories with commas.
